“There is a magic in graphs. The profile of a curve reveals in a flash a whole situation — the life history of an epidemic, a panic, or an era of prosperity. The curve informs the mind, awakens the imagination, convinces,” Henry D. Hubbard – member of the U.S. Bureau of Standards.

Data is often complex. There is no denying that. Making data comprehensible, insightful and actionable is key. The best way to do that is through visualizations and graphs.

According to the Social Science Research Network, 65% of the population are visual learners. In business, visual data discovery can enhance both your personal productivity and your entire organization's output. Visual data discovery does this by helping you and your staff make important decisions faster. In fact, managers in organizations using visual data discovery were found to be 28% more likely to get access to information when they need it, compared to peers who just use managed reporting and dashboards.

Optimal Targeting CEO David Konigsberg reported our brain processes visuals 60,000 times faster than text. He went on to say 90% of information transmitted to the brain is visual, 70% of your sensory receptors are in your eyes, 50% of your brain is active in visual processing and 40% of people respond better to visuals.

In a recent series on the Past, Present and Future of BI, Paul Robertson explained that as more staff members are making data-driven decisions and making them quickly, the business benefits of using a business intelligence tool are greater.

‘Data discovery’ is the term used to describe the act of discovering opportunities that are hidden within the data of company business systems. Data discovery is not just about reports - it’s about following your train of thought through all of your data including grids, visualizations and dashboards.

Some of the benefits of using data-visualisation are:

  1. see relationships and patterns between operational and business activities
  2. identify and act on emerging trends faster
  3. tell a story with your data
  4. enhances employee productivity
